Calcul durée entre 2 dates et heures

Calcul durée entre 2 dates et heures - VB/VBA/VBS - Programmation

Marsh Posté le 12-10-2018 à 14:02:45    

Bonjour
je cherche a calculer le temps passé entre 2 moments, au format heure
 
en A1, j'ai 01/01/2018 15:00
en B1, j'ai 09/01/2018 09:45
en C1 je voudrais        xxx:xx     (en heure:minutes)
 
la durée que je veux récupérer est le temps séparant ces 2 moments, en enlevant, les samedi, dimanche, et nuit(-8h)  
 
sauriez vous faire, avec des formules excel, ou en VBA

Reply

Marsh Posté le 12-10-2018 à 14:02:45   

Reply

Marsh Posté le 19-10-2018 à 09:49:25    

A part te le palucher a l'os (vérifier chaque jour si c'est un samedi ou dimanche, retirer 8h a chaque fois qu'une nuit passe (bien définir les heures...)  
Tu as aussi la fonction :
=NB.JOURS.OUVRES(dateDébut ; dateFin ; [joursFériés] )
https://excel.quebec/excel-formules [...] rs-ouvres/
 qui peut t'intéresser...
 
Sinon, est-ce que les A1 et B1 sont saisis en texte ou en valeur DateTime ?

Reply

Marsh Posté le 19-10-2018 à 23:06:12    

Attention aussi au changement d'heure d'été/hivers.


---------------
Astres, outil de help-desk GPL : http://sourceforge.net/projects/astres, ICARE, gestion de conf : http://sourceforge.net/projects/icare, Outil Planeta Calandreta : https://framalibre.org/content/planeta-calandreta
Reply

Marsh Posté le 20-10-2018 à 14:39:37    

Merci, je connaissais jours.ouvres
la formule a l'air simple pour y inclure les jours féries
 
j'ai trouvé une formule bien faite sur un autre forum, qui tient compte:
-des jours ouvres
-des jours féries paramétrables
-des heures de travails parametrables
 
une belle formule de 4 lignes ...
j’essaierai de retrouver la source, et la mettrai ici

Reply

Marsh Posté le 06-11-2018 à 15:57:59    

bonjour,
Daniel-12, la solution pourrait m'interresser si cela fonctionne chez toi...
peux tu la poster
MERCI

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ed